Copyright and Birthday Cakes

Copyright and Birthday Cakes

Dues to threats of copyright infringement lawsuits, this bakery now refuses to customize birthday cakes with the kids' beloved images, e.g. if a kid wants a Nemo cake, too bad. After all, how dare that little hooligan punk kid want to "steal" the "property" of Disney et al.? What right does he have to have an orange fish on his cake? The Bill of Rights does not say anything at all about a right-to-put-an-orange-Nemo-resembling-fish-on-a-birthday-cake. Does it? No, I didn't think so!
